Tonga latest to experience dengue problems

7:02 pm on 27 February 2014

The latest Pacific nation to report problems with dengue is Tonga with the ministry of health confirming their second recorded case of the year.

Both cases were reported to Vaiola Hospital in Nuku'alofa this month.

Radio Tonga reports health authorities calling on the public to reduce the threat of dengue by eliminating mosquito breeding areas.

Dengue has struck French Polynesia, Fiji, Vanuatu, the Cook Islands and Kiribati this year.
